During a conversation with CNN’s Christiane Amanpour on “News Central” Monday, former German Chancellor Angela Merkel shared insights about Donald Trump’s apparent fascination with authoritarian leadership styles.

When Amanpour brought up Merkel’s conditional welcome of Trump’s initial election, which was based on democratic values and principles, she asked about Trump’s evident interest in the Russian president.

“Well, in the way that he spoke about Putin, the way that he spoke about the North Korean president, obviously, apart from critical remarks he made, there was always a kind of fascination at the sheer power of what these people could do. So my impression always was that he dreamt of actually overriding maybe all those parliamentary bodies that he felt were, in a way, an encumbrance upon him and that he wanted to decide matters on his own. And in a democracy, well, you cannot reconcile that with democratic values,” Merkel responded.

The former German leader’s observations highlighted Trump’s apparent admiration for leaders who wielded unconditional power, suggesting a concerning disconnect between his leadership inclinations and fundamental democratic principles.
